Background:
In February 2015, the City Council adopted Ordinance #7588 creating the Economic Development Incentive Policy.

In October 2015, the City Council amended the Policy by adoption of Ordinance #7725.

Since that time staff has administratively updated the policy as changes in City Council have occurred as needed.

In August 2017, staff presented the Community and Economic Development Committee (CEDC) with an overview of the City's Economic Development Incentive Policy and how it has been utilized. In addition, staff provided suggestions to the CEDC for consideration and received feedback to incorporate these suggested changes within the Policy.

On September 8, 2017 staff presented the CEDC with proposed amendments incorporated into the Policy along with an ordinance to consider for recommendation to full City Council. The CEDC recommended the Council approve the amendments to the Policy and requested staff provide a presentation first to the City Council, prior to the City Council considering the ordinance to adopt the proposed amendments.
